مشاركة عبر


ملاحظات إصدار الذكاء الاصطناعي Shell

هام

اعتبارا من يناير 2026، لم يعد مشروع شل الذكاء الاصطناعي قيد الصيانة النشطة. يجب اعتبار هذا المشروع مؤرشفا من الناحية الهندسية.

توضح هذه الوثيقة التغييرات والتحسينات التي تم إجراؤها في كل إصدار من الذكاء الاصطناعي Shell. للحصول على قائمة أكثر اكتمالا بالتغييرات، راجع صفحة الإصدارات على GitHub.

1.0.0-معاينة.7 - 2025-09-05

يتضمن هذا الإصدار التغييرات التالية:

  • الانتقال إلى Azure.Identity v1.14.2 وإعادة بناء التعليمات البرمجية لمكتبة بيانات تتبع الاستخدام (#404)
  • استخدم shell تسجيل الدخول على macOS للبدء aish في جزء sidecar لوراثة PATH المناسب (# 403)
  • وصف أداة الهروب بشكل صحيح لتجنب كائن الترميز المشوه ( # 408 )
  • إضافة نماذج gpt-5 إلى قائمة النماذج المدعومة ( # 409)
  • تحديث اسم ملف المحفوظات واستبعاد بيانات اعتماد البيئة والهوية المدارة من تدفق مصادقة Azure (#412)
  • احتفظ بالغلاف الأصلي لاسم الطراز لنقطة النهاية المخصصة لتمكين Foundry Local ( # 413 )

1.0.0-معاينة.6 -- 2025-07-24

يتضمن هذا الإصدار التغييرات التالية:

  • تحديث سلسلة اتصال AppInsights لاستخدام بيئة الإنتاج الجديدة (#390)
  • اجعل AIShell عميل MCP لعرض أدوات MCP لوكلائها (# 392)
  • إضافة أدوات مضمنة إلى AIShell (# 394)
  • إصلاح خطأ استثناء المرجع الفارغ عند عدم توفر الأدوات المضمنة (#396)
  • تحسين Resolve-Error الأمر والسماح بموجه النظام الافتراضي للعامل openai-gpt (# 397)
  • إضافة الأداة run_command_in_terminal المضمنة ل الذكاء الاصطناعي لتنفيذ الأوامر في جلسة PowerShell المتصلة (#398) - هذه الأداة ممكنة حاليا فقط على Windows.

1.0.0-معاينة.5 -- 2025-06-13

هذا الإصدار هو تصحيح أمان فقط، بما في ذلك التغييرات التالية:

  • قم بالترقية إلى .NET SDK 8.0.411 لمعالجة مشكلة أمان .NET CVE-2025-30399: ثغرة أمنية في التعليمات البرمجية عن بعد .NET
  • OpenAI الوكيل: التحديث DefaultAzureCredential للسماح InteractiveBrowserCredential (# 383)

1.0.0-معاينة.4 -- 2025-05-15

يتضمن هذا الإصدار التغييرات التالية:

  • دعم نشر التعليمات البرمجية من السيارة الجانبية AIShell إلى PowerShell باستخدام Invoke-AIShell -PostCode (# 361)
  • تحسين موثوقية Start-AIShell نظام التشغيل macOS (#362)
  • نشر حزمة NuGet ووحدة PowerShell النمطية في إصدار مربع النشر (#365)
  • إصلاح نشر التعليمات البرمجية على macOS: دعم نشر التعليمات البرمجية عن طريق التشغيل /code post من السيارة الجانبية AIShell والتشغيل Invoke-AIShell -PostCode من PowerShell (# 366)
  • تحديث معلومات النموذج لدعم نماذج OpenAI الجديدة (# 368)
  • أضف /clear كاسم مستعار إلى الأمر /cls لمسح وحدة التحكم في AIShell (#370)
  • تجاهل العامل النشط الحالي من نتائج إكمال العامل للمشغل @ (#372)
  • تحديث البرنامج النصي للتثبيت لتثبيت وحدة AIShell على macOS أيضا (#374)
  • إدارة النموذج المحسنة والتكامل الفوري للنظام في OllamaAgent (#351)
  • إضافة عامل Phi Silica لأجهزة "مساعد الطيار + الكمبيوتر" (# 373)
  • استخدم مربع النشر والمهمة GitHubRelease لإنشاء إصدار مسودة GitHub (#379)
  • تأكد من توفر Runspace الوحدة عند استيراد AIShell الوحدة ورميها بطريقة أخرى (# 379)

1.0.0-معاينة.3 - 2025-03-12

يتضمن هذا الإصدار التغييرات التالية:

  • قم بتحديث أعلام الطيران وقم بإجراء التغييرات المقابلة على azure الوكيل (#349, #355)
  • قم بتحديث التعبير العادي لمطابقة سلاسل الاقتباس الفردي والاقتباس المزدوج ل PowerShell وبناء Bash الجملة (#357)
  • إضافة دعم لمصادقة معرف Entra عند استخدام interpreter الوكلاء أو openai-gpt (#356)
  • تحديث install-aishell.ps1 للسماح للمستخدم بتحديد الإصدار المراد تثبيته (#345)

1.0.0-معاينة.2 -- 2025-02-26

يتضمن هذا الإصدار التغييرات التالية:

  • تحقق من إذن التنفيذ وإزالته من ملف التكوين (# 317)
  • استخدم nano أو $EDITOR (إذا تم تعريفه) لفتح ملف التكوين على Linux (# 318)
  • إعادة بناء العنصر العامل openai-gpt للانتقال إلى Azure.AI.OpenAI الإصدار 2.1.0 (#328)
  • إضافة دعم إلى بيانات اعتماد تسجيل الدخول إلى Azure PowerShell (#329)
  • السماح باستخدام خدمات الذكاء الاصطناعي التابعة لجهة خارجية المتوافقة مع تنسيق OpenAI API في openai-gpt الوكيل (#331)
  • تحقق من وجود تحديث قبل إرجاع وصف الوكيل openai-gpt (#332)
  • استخدم #7a7a7a كلون رمادي في AIShell لتلبية متطلبات التباين (# 333)
  • قم بإزالة المنطق الاحتياطي للتحقق من التفويض والتزم بعنوان URL للإنتاج (#334)
  • التقاط إخراج الأمر الأصلي باستخدام واجهة برمجة تطبيقات تجريف الشاشة على Windows (# 335)
  • إضافة shell كاسم مستعار إلى المحلل Bash اللغوي (#336)
  • تمكين pluginstore اسم الموضوع وتحديثه لمعالج واجهة سطر الأوامر (CLI) (#337)
  • تسجيل نص الاستجابة إذا تم طرح الاستثناء أثناء معالجة استعلام مستخدم (#338)
  • تمكين إدخال المعلمات لاستجابة Azure PowerShell (#339)
  • إصلاح الإصدار للحفاظ على إذن الملف لحزم Linux و macOS (# 344)
  • إصلاح تحليل أوامر AzCLI للتعامل مع العلامات الطويلة / القصيرة وعند عدم وجود معلمة (# 344)
  • تنفيذ سياق المحادثة والبث للوكيل Ollama باستخدام OllamaSharp (#310)
  • إضافة مستندات وملفات لنشر مثيل Azure OpenAI عبر ملف Bicep (#324)
  • تعديل الملف التمهيدي والوكيل للإشارة إلى المستندات (#326)

1.0.0-معاينة.1 -- 2024-11-15

الذكاء الاصطناعي Shell هي أداة CLI جديدة تنشئ غلافا تفاعليا لتوصيلك بمساعدي الذكاء الاصطناعي المختلفين. نشير إلى مساعدي الذكاء الاصطناعي المختلفين هؤلاء على أنهم عوامل الذكاء الاصطناعي. يتضمن الذكاء الاصطناعي Shell وكلاء افتراضيا:

  • Azure Copilot
  • Azure OpenAI

الميزات الأساسية

  • دردشة تفاعلية للتحدث إلى وكلاء الذكاء الاصطناعي
  • عرض ردود تخفيض السعر
  • أوامر الدردشة / للتفاعل مع استجابات التعليمات البرمجية من عامل الذكاء الاصطناعي المفضل